-- n. Methods for Modern Sculptors by Ronald D. Young Methods for Modern Sculptors is a "how to" book for the hands on type of sculptor who wants to learn to cast their own metal... This book covers waxes, sprues, mold making, ceramic shell casting, dewaxing, melting and pouring metal, welding, chasing, cleaning, and polishing. Complete details on the formulation and handling of a ceramic shell slurry is also included along with how to build kilns and furnaces. Also, a glossary of terms, directory of suppliers, the history of bronze, and a bibliography for further reading... (Read More) |
